The Women's Teva ReEmber Shoes will be the shoes you live in. The Women's Teva ReEmber Shoes offer the comfort and warmth of an indoor slipper with durability and comfort that makes them perfect for outdoor wear. The 100% recycled ripstop, rib knit, and microfiber construction helps the Teva ReEmber stand up to the elements while the responsive PU footbed cushions every step. You'll love wearing the Women's Teva ReEmber Shoes with every outfit.

I've had these for a week and put a few miles on them walking around the campground, short trails and while running errands. Out of the box they were a very snug fit but I figured they would stretch out, which they did. Unfortunately now the heel slips sometimes. The heel could have better support as they tend to roll. Overall I'm satisfied and glad I got them on sale.
Considered these for fall/winter camp shoes instead of house slippers; but turns out they work better as house slippers. Not better. Pretty great, actually. Grip well on stair risers and other home surfaces. Have worn them to do quick errands outside. The collapsible heel still holds tight if you need to pull it up over for longer treks. If they were lighter I might take them on a backpacking trip and 5-star them but for now will keep using my Exped Camp slippers and keep the Tevas for home.
I gave 2 starts for the quality and materials. However, this shoe has only limited use if you need to go somewhere closeby. There is absolutely no support for the hill since the back side of the shoe made from a soft material. Yes you can wear those as a sleepers and this would be cool. But when you are trying to wear them as such, there the sole is not long enough and your hill is about to sleep off. Unless you get them a size or two larger than what you need, this shoe can only work if you need to wonder on a backyard, or swing to a convenient store. For eighty bucks - I would not recommend them. Only if you can get them at a deep discount as those have very limited use. For the reference. I have them in size 11.
Wife bought it for me to wear it around the house for the cold mornings here in so cal so like for two months I’ll consistently wear them. It’s a shame that after a season, that they’ve ripped so easily and I would wear them ripped except the inner sole slips out and won’t stay put. Looks like other side is about to rip soon too. I do have calloused heals but I take good care of them so that they are smooth. Wish they make them more durable.
These Tevas have a unique look and get compliments often but I wouldn't recommend them for feet that require cushion. The quilted look makes them look like you'd be walking on clouds but that's not the case. The rubber outsole is rather stiff and the insole is not cushioned. Also, the midsole became unglued from the outsole too soon and I only wear them occasionally. As for fit, they are very wide, even with socks. I use mine as slippers when I'm just chilling around the house.
This is my second pair of TEVA slip-ons. The first pair I got almost 4 years ago. They are a women's size 7. The pair I just received is not a size 7. it is about a half an in short that the older pair and the shoe is about a quarter of an in narrow then my original pair. I am going to order the next size up, but I think that TEVA really needs to look at the sizing as a size 7 shoe should not get smaller over time. Other than that, I do love the slip-ons and the colors. Quality is very good.
I feel that these run a little small, tight, and narrow at front especially with socks on. Maybe without socks it’s ok. I think these are cute color patterns but wish they were easier to just slip on and stay on. I almost feel as if my foot is being pushed out (if I don’t use the back flap up). So, if I try to just use as a quick slipper out of the house or tent it’s really not that comfortable/secure feeling.
